加入两个query_posts代码

时间:2011-11-24 16:12:00

标签: php categories jquery-post

如何加入这两个代码以便它们起作用?

<?php query_posts( array(
  'posts_per_page' => 16,
  'paged' => ( get_query_var('paged') ? get_query_var('paged') : 1 ), ));
?>

<?php query_posts('category_name=' . $category->cat_name . '&paged='. get_query_var('paged')); ?>

第一个有工作导航(当我点击较旧/较新的帖子时),而第二个没有(它返回具有正确URL的同一页面)。我的其他模板遇到了这个问题所以我使用上面发布的代码让导航工作。 此外,第一个代码显示16个帖子,第二个代码仅显示5个。

我尝试通过将这两行添加到第二个代码来组合它们但是它给我一个错误,给我一个不工作的导航或它只是给出了16个帖子但没有按类别显示。

1 个答案:

答案 0 :(得分:1)

尝试:

<?php 
  query_posts( 
    array(
      'posts_per_page' => 16,
      'paged' => ( get_query_var('paged') ? get_query_var('paged') : 1 ), 
      'category_name' => $category->cat_name
    )
  );
?>